Release note:
File in LittleThings61.st, find the LittleThings category and the ArrangedTiles
class in your browser and read the class comment. Or (if you are too impatient
to do it) make sure you have a Transcript window opened (important!),
write "x := ArrangedTiles new. x runAway" to a Workspace, select it, "do" it,
and watch. (When you have had enough of watching, you have to break the process
manually as instructed by the application's display panel.)
